Sr. Community Philanthropy Specialist

Eohh · Houston, TX, United States

Imported listingfull-timeabout 2 hours ago

About The Role

The Senior Community Philanthropy Specialist leads community-based fundraising initiatives that engage individuals, businesses, and community organizations in supporting Texas Children’s. This role manages a diverse portfolio of fundraising partnerships, develops strategies to grow revenue and engagement, and builds strong community relationships that drive sustainable philanthropic support.

What You’ll Do

  • Manage a diverse portfolio of revenue-generating partnerships, including third-party events, peer-to-peer fundraising campaigns, Children’s Miracle Network partners, cause marketing, and point-of-sale initiatives.
  • Develop and execute annual fundraising plans and 12–18 month strategies to achieve revenue goals.
  • Build and strengthen relationships with businesses, community organizations, fundraising partners, and individuals.
  • Provide strategic guidance, tools, and support to external event organizers and fundraising partners to maximize engagement and fundraising results.
  • Partner with Major Gift Officers to identify and engage community fundraising prospects and help build the philanthropic pipeline.
  • Represent Texas Children’s at fundraising events, check presentations, community activations, and partner meetings.
  • Serve as an ambassador for Texas Children’s by sharing our mission and strengthening relationships throughout the community.
  • Monitor fundraising performance, analyze results, and identify opportunities for growth and innovation.
  • Maintain accurate donor and prospect activity, engagement, and next steps in the CRM.
  • Collaborate with internal teams to ensure alignment with organizational goals, brand standards, and donor stewardship practices.

What You’ll Bring

  • Bachelor’s degree required.
  • 3+ years of experience in fundraising, event planning, business, project management, community relations, healthcare, or a related field.
  • Experience with fundraising events, community partnerships, corporate relationships, or revenue-generating programs preferred.
  • Strong relationship-building, communication, presentation, and organizational sk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ple projects and priorities while meeting goals and deadlines.
  • Creative, proactive, and results-oriented approach to building relationships and driving fundraising outcomes.
  • Ability to work collaboratively with a wide range of internal and external partners.
